    In urban areas, volatile organic compounds are important ambient pollutants because of their detrimental effects on human health and their role in the chemistry of atmosphere as precursors of ozone and other oxidants. The concentration of C[EQUATION]H[EQUATION] was analyzed by Fourier transform infrared spectroscopy. The variation of the long-time trends of the C[EQUATION]H[EQUATION] concentrations in Beijing may be ascribed to the emission changes from the plane and the motor vehicle. During Beijing Olympic Games, the C[EQUATION]H[EQUATION] concentrations in Beijing Capital Airport may be ascribed to the emission changes of planes, and the C[EQUATION]H[EQUATION] concentrations have good relativity with the quantity of planes.
